Why AI matters at this scale

Wold Architects and Engineers operates in a sweet spot for AI adoption: large enough to have accumulated decades of project data and standardized BIM workflows, yet small enough to pivot quickly without the bureaucratic drag of a mega-firm. With 201-500 employees and a focus on repeatable building types—K-12 schools, hospitals, government facilities—the firm sits on a goldmine of structured design patterns. AI can unlock that latent value, addressing the industry's twin pressures: a tightening labor market for experienced architects and escalating client demands for faster, cheaper, greener buildings.

For a firm founded in 1968, the institutional knowledge is immense but often siloed in senior staff nearing retirement. AI offers a way to capture and scale that expertise, turning past project performance into predictive guidance for younger teams. Moreover, the A/E sector is notoriously slow to adopt new tech, meaning early movers like Wold can differentiate sharply in a competitive market. The key is starting with high-ROI, low-disruption use cases that complement existing Revit-centric workflows.

Three concrete AI opportunities with ROI framing

1. Generative design for K-12 prototypes. School districts often request multiple site-fit studies under tight deadlines. By training a generative model on Wold’s past school layouts, the firm could produce compliant, optimized floor plans in hours instead of weeks. Assuming a typical feasibility study costs $15,000 in labor, cutting that by 40% across 20 pursuits per year saves $120,000 annually—while improving win rates through faster, data-backed responses.

2. Automated energy modeling for healthcare. Hospitals are energy hogs, and owners increasingly demand early-phase performance analysis. AI-driven tools like Autodesk Forma or custom machine learning models can predict EUI (energy use intensity) from massing models in real time. This reduces the need for specialized consultants at concept stage, potentially saving $8,000-$12,000 per project and accelerating sustainability certifications that unlock grants or tax credits.

3. Predictive risk analytics on project delivery. By feeding historical data on change orders, RFIs, and schedule slips into a machine learning model, Wold could forecast trouble spots on active jobs. Flagging a high-risk subcontractor or design ambiguity before it becomes a $50,000 change order delivers direct bottom-line impact. Even a 10% reduction in unbudgeted rework across a $65M revenue base represents significant margin improvement.

Deployment risks specific to this size band

Mid-market firms face a “valley of death” in AI adoption: too big for off-the-shelf consumer tools, too small for dedicated data science teams. The primary risk is underinvestment in data hygiene. Wold’s legacy project files likely contain inconsistent naming, incomplete metadata, and 2D CAD remnants that will frustrate any AI initiative. A dedicated “data steward” role—even part-time—is essential before launching models.

Change management is the second hurdle. Senior designers may distrust black-box algorithms, fearing erosion of professional judgment. The antidote is transparent, assistive AI that explains its reasoning and keeps the human in the loop. Finally, software costs can spiral if not tied to a clear use case. Wold should pilot one high-impact application, measure results rigorously, and only then scale. Starting with AI features already embedded in its existing Autodesk ecosystem minimizes procurement friction and training overhead.
